High-Load Oil-Embedded Thrust Bearings

Increased iron content makes these bearings stronger and more resistant to shock loads than standard oil-embedded bearings; however they operate at lower speeds. Startup friction causes these bearings to release a thin layer of oil onto their surface. Color is silver because of the iron.
863 iron-copper bearings are also known as Super Oilite® bearings.
Iron-copper bearings support heavier loads than 863 iron-copper bearings.

Linear Sleeve Bearings


Bearings are for use with round end-supported shafts. To install, slide bearings into a housing (not included) and secure with two retaining rings (sold individually).
Bearings with 0.0005" shaft clearance are best for precision applications. Bearings with 0.001" or 0.0015" shaft clearance are less likely to bind on your shaft than bearings with 0.0005" shaft clearance.
Self Aligning—Bearings compensate for shaft misalignment.
Fixed Alignment—Bearings are for use where shaft misalignment is unlikely.
Frelon-lined bearings are wear and chemical resistant. Frelon-lined aluminum bearings have good corrosion resistance. Note: Not for use with bare aluminum, chrome-plated steel, or 300 series stainless steel shafts. Frelon-lined 316 stainless steel bearings have excellent corrosion resistance. Note: Not for use with chrome-plated steel.
PTFE-lined bearings are chemical resistant and nonabrasive. They have a ceramic coating for added corrosion resistance.

Bearing Retaining Locknuts



With a nylon insert that grips your threaded shaft or spindle without damaging its threads, these locknuts—also called shaft nuts—hold bearings, bushings, gears, and pulleys prone to vibration tightly in place. They come as one piece, so you can easily clamp them onto your shaft or spindle. But, since they aren’t made entirely of metal, they don’t stand up to heat as well as all-metal locknuts. Slots in their sides mean you can tighten and loosen them with a spanner wrench or spanner socket. Their face is also chamfered to help keep the size and weight of your assembly at a minimum. All meet international standards for bearing locknut dimensions.
When choosing your thread spacing, consider the precision of your application. The finer the threads, the more control you have when making adjustments.
All carbon steel locknuts are strong and resist wear, though they don’t stand up to corrosion as well as stainless steel locknuts. 303 stainless steel locknuts resist corrosion better than steel locknuts but aren’t as strong. They withstand washdowns and chemicals.
